In a deeply emotional turn of events on Coronation Street, Debbie Webster (Sue Devaney) faces a devastating health crisis that leaves her loved ones reeling, particularly Abi Webster (Sally Carman), whose own struggles threaten to overwhelm her.(Corrie News)

Debbie’s secret battle with early-onset dementia reaches a critical point during a local wedding fayre. While attempting to move a stand, she injures herself, prompting Ronnie Bailey to insist on taking her to the hospital. However, Debbie becomes increasingly panicked when questioned about her medical history, driving Ronnie away to hide her vulnerability. (The Sun)

Later, during a dinner with Abi, Debbie secretly consumes vodka, leading to her becoming unsteady and disoriented. Abi, concerned for her friend, calls Carl for support. It is then that Debbie finally reveals her devastating diagnosis to Carl, confessing that she has received news about her health that she can no longer keep hidden. (The Sun)

The emotional weight of Debbie’s confession is compounded by Abi’s own mental health struggles. Still haunted by the murder of Mason Radcliffe and visions of her late son Seb, Abi experiences a harrowing breakdown. Her grief is so intense that she begins to see and hear Seb, leading to a terrifying hallucination where she believes she sees herself cradling his body. This incident leaves her overwhelmed and in need of support. (Digital Spy, The Sun, Digital Spy)

Amidst these personal crises, Kevin Webster is dealing with his own health scare after discovering a lump and fearing it may be testicular cancer. Unable to share his concerns with Abi, who is already overwhelmed, Kevin confides in Tim instead. This secrecy adds to the tension within the family, as each member grapples with their own fears and uncertainties. (The Sun)

The situation escalates when Abi, while taking Alfie to pick up Kevin from his ultrasound appointment, has another panic attack upon seeing the site of Mason’s death. She exits the car, transfixed, and imagines herself cradling Seb’s body. Overwhelmed by terror and guilt, she runs away, leaving Kevin to find Debbie, not Abi, waiting for him at the hospital. Upon returning home, Kevin finds Abi curled up on the sofa, still haunted by her hallucination. When Kevin offers to pick up Alfie from the childminder, Abi reacts with horror, leading to a confrontation that leaves Kevin reeling. (Digital Spy, Digital Spy)

Debbie, concerned for Abi’s mental state and Alfie’s safety, shares her worries with Ronnie. Abi is shocked to find Kevin seated at the table with a social worker and becomes furious, convinced that Debbie has reported her. This accusation further strains the already fragile relationships within the family. (Digital Spy, Digital Spy)

As Debbie’s health deteriorates, she becomes increasingly disoriented, culminating in an encounter with Mick Michaelis that leaves her dazed and confused. This incident marks a pivotal moment in Debbie’s ongoing dementia storyline, leading to her character’s eventual death. Fans are distressed by Debbie’s impending departure and have petitioned against it, highlighting the emotional impact of her storyline. (The Sun)

Debbie’s dementia plot promises to be one of the most emotional and memorable storylines in Coronation Street’s history, ensuring a dramatic and heartfelt exit for Sue Devaney’s character. As the Webster family navigates these challenging times, viewers are left to wonder how they will cope with the impending loss and whether they can find strength in each other to overcome their personal battles.(The Sun)

While Emmerdale’s Aaron Dingle faces betrayal, secrets, and emotional chaos on screen, the man behind the role—Danny Miller—has never looked happier in real life. The beloved soap actor has shared a deeply moving update that has fans in tears for all the right reasons: his growing family. Just weeks after welcoming his third child, Danny took to Instagram to post a joyful holiday snap with wife Steph and their children—marking their first trip away as a family of five. Beaming from the pool with their two older kids, Albert and Edith, Danny captioned the post with simple yet powerful words: “Family: where life begins and love never ends.” It was a moment of pure contrast to the heartache unfolding for Aaron in Emmerdale. On the show, Aaron has had a turbulent 2025: still reeling from Anthony Fox’s death, navigating a tense marriage to John Sugden, and facing the emotional return of his ex-husband, Robert. Viewers know that while Aaron appears loyal to John for now, he remains dangerously unaware of John’s darkest secret—John accidentally killed Nate Robinson while trying to “save” him. It’s only a matter of time before Aaron’s world unravels again. But off-screen? Danny is basking in peace and gratitude. The actor, who made his Emmerdale debut as Aaron in 2008, has tackled countless emotionally wrenching scenes over the years—from struggles with identity to heartbreak and loss. And yet, fans say his latest real-life post shows more joy than even his happiest fictional moment. Holding his wife, with children clinging to his side and a newborn in their arms, Danny’s happiness is radiant. Just days earlier, Danny had posted a heartwarming welcome to the newest member of the family: “Welcome Vincent Miller. Born 10/07/25, Weighing 8lb 8oz. We could not be happier with our family of 5.” The video of Albert and Edith meeting their baby brother for the first time only added to the emotional impact—brother and sister walking hand-in-hand toward their mum, their eyes filled with curiosity and wonder. The response online was overwhelming. Fans flooded the comments with love: “Gorgeous wee family, it’s heartwarming to see”, one wrote. Another added, “Love watching your family grow.” And perhaps the most touching message of all came from Danny himself, just days before: “Never in my life did I think I’d find happiness of this level… so here’s a picture to describe it for me.” While Aaron Dingle may be on the verge of heartbreak, Danny Miller is living a chapter filled with love, legacy, and new beginnings. It’s a beautiful reminder that even when fiction brings tears, real life can offer peace.
